Principal job Isolation

One of the biggest problems principals are facing at present is job isolation. This is coming through time and tome again in coaching sessions. I feel this could be easily addressed by setting up regular face to face get togethers for principals where they could meet and share job related discussions. If face to face seems too difficult or challenging then online could/should also be considered. Some will argue principals could do this for themselves. but systemic involvement would greatly enhance this .

After a great final coaching session this afternoon I was reminded of this picture. Growth very often demands courage and I was immediately conscious of the courage this principal has shown in implementing necessary changes in their school.Recognising the need for change while essential in leadership does not in any way guarantee it’s implementation...it needs action and that demands courage. Coaching raises awareness of what needs to happen, but only action on the part of the coaches leads to change. It is very gratifying to see this as a coach: to see that limiting assumptions, rumination and personal vulnerability have been overcome and been replaced by satisfaction, sense of achievement and change has been initiated. Leadership confidence has been strengthened, resilience built upon and new skills acquired. Well done!
